Does Top Grain Leather Peel Off. When top grain leather is pigmented, it maintains an even tone with no patina. Despite its durability, top grain leather remains supple and comfortable. Leather jacket peeling or flaking occurs when the leather jacket is stored wrongly, or it has been exposed to heat, very cold, or any acidic element. Top grain leather is stiffer and thus making it a perfect choice for belts and shoes. Top grain leather which has a semi aniline dye and protective coating will peel over time.
